When we say this car has a lot of power, you might want to have a comparison to make sure you can have the power you\u2019ve been looking for. This new Corvette has the ability to give you 755 horsepower and 715 lb.-ft. of torque from the 6.2-liter supercharged V8 engine, which is more than the power that you\u2019ll find in the following models.<!--more--><br \/>\n<strong>Aston Martin DB11<\/strong> \u2013 As the car you can see the starring in the next James Bond movie and one that offers the smooth feeling and look you desire, the DB11 won\u2019t be able to chase down the bad guys if they drive the new Corvette ZR1. The DB 11 brings you 600 horsepower and has a larger engine to make it one that\u2019s heavier as well as slower.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Audi R8 V10 Plus<\/strong> \u2013 Here is another car that\u2019s been admired at the top of its lineup and is one that brings you all the power you\u2019re looking for. This incredible Audi is powered by a 5.2-liter V10 to make 610 horsepower, but that\u2019s still a lot less than what the Corvette ZR1 offers, making it the choice you\u2019ll want to avoid.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Dodge Viper ACR<\/strong> \u2013 The Dodge Viper is one of the most aggressive cars offered on the market and it\u2019s a serious contender on any track you take it to. This car is another that\u2019s powered by a larger engine than the Corvette ZR1. This car uses an 8.4-liter V10 engine to produce 645 horsepower and 600 lb.-ft. of torque for the drive on the track.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Ferrari 488 GTB<\/strong> \u2013 You might not have thought you would see a Ferrari on this list, but this one is a model that can offer you the power you want from the 3.9-liter twin turbocharged V8 engine that gives you 661 horsepower and 561 lb.-ft. of torque. This car is a gorgeous model that might challenge the Corvette for looks, but this car is one that can\u2019t catch it on the track.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Ford GT<\/strong> \u2013 While this is the most impressive supercar from Ford, you\u2019re going to have the drive you want and the fun of this active car, but not the power of the Corvette ZR1. The GT uses a 3.5-liter EcoBoost V6 to offer up 647 ponies from the engine, but it isn\u2019t one that will be able to challenge the ZR1 on the track.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Lamborghini Aventador SV<\/strong> \u2013 Here is another model that you wouldn\u2019t expect to be on this list because it truly brings the heat with some serious power. The Aventador shows up with a massive 6.5-liter V12 engine that produces 740 horsepower and 509 lb.-ft. of torque, but that\u2019s still less than what you\u2019ll find in the Corvette ZR1 that you want to drive.<\/p>\n<p><strong>McLaren 720S<\/strong> \u2013 This car is one of the lightest supercars on the market and is truly a racing machine that you\u2019ll want to enjoy, but it\u2019s still not as powerful as the Corvette ZR1. This car is powered by a 4.0-liter twin turbocharged V8 to give you 710 horsepower on the track in a car that\u2019s light and ready to drive but one that will stare at the rear bumper of the Corvette.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Nissan GT-R NISMO<\/strong> \u2013 If you\u2019re looking for a car that\u2019s been in the headlines many times over the years, this is the one. This car makes use of a 3.8-liter twin turbocharged V6 engine to offer up 600 horsepower and 481 lb.-ft. of torque. Even at this impressive number in this small and active supercar you\u2019re going to be able to enjoy more in the Corvette ZR1.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Pagani Huayra<\/strong> \u2013 Here is a car that happens to be one of the rarest and most impressive supercars on the market, but it still can\u2019t give you the drive you want with the power of the Corvette ZR1. Using a 6.0-liter twin turbocharged V12 engine this car can give you 720 horsepower so that you can have the fun you want but not as much as the Corvette.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Porsche 911 GT2 RS<\/strong> \u2013 One of the most aggressive sports cars from Porsche is the GT2 RS model that make use of a 3.8-liter twin turbocharged six-cylinder engine that can provide you with 700 horsepower and 553 lb.-ft. of torque. This car will still look at the rear of the Corvette ZR1 as it blows by on the track with its impressive amount of power.<\/p>\n<p><span class=\"embed-youtube\" style=\"text-align:center; display: block;\"><iframe loading=\"lazy\" class=\"youtube-player\" width=\"640\" height=\"360\" src=\"https:\/\/www.youtube.com\/embed\/j7j1gCM6-5M?version=3&#038;rel=1&#038;showsearch=0&#038;showinfo=1&#038;iv_load_policy=1&#038;fs=1&#038;hl=en-US&#038;autohide=2&#038;wmode=transparent\" allowfullscreen=\"true\" style=\"border:0;\" sandbox=\"allow-scripts allow-same-origin allow-popups allow-presentation allow-popups-to-escape-sandbox\"><\/iframe><\/span><\/p>\n<p>Want something a little more family-oriented?
